Output dd94bc43f1818d8b65c55ad0edde54eb368546ee4ef3e02c77fe47c69430373b:0

value
589882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81de1f33e724b43e845480589cdbcfb9471a4759 OP_EQUAL
address
3DXhBb7rjWF8UxCc7BWnN18rqHpZxYMwgR
transaction
dd94bc43f1818d8b65c55ad0edde54eb368546ee4ef3e02c77fe47c69430373b
spent
true